What is the main concern of school counseling?

Counselors can give you tips on standing up for yourself if you’re being bullied, managing stress, talking to your parents, and dealing with anger and other difficult moods. Counselors also can advise you on problems you may have with a teacher, such as communication difficulties or questions over grades.

How do school counselors impact student achievement?

School Counselors Help Support Student Achievement by Using Data. Interventions with students who are failing may include: individual planning, parent phone calls, academic or study skills groups, whole group study skills, or test taking lessons. Counselors also rely on discipline data to improve academic achievement.

    How do school counselors and school counseling programs positively impact students and their success?

    Those individuals attending schools with strong counseling programs reported a higher level of academic achievement; a greater sense of happiness, safety and security at their institution; and fewer problems with socializing and interpersonal relationships.

    How does counseling help solve problems?

    Counseling offers people the opportunity to identify the factors that contribute to their difficulties and to deal effectively with the psychological, behavioral, interpersonal and situational causes of those difficulties.
